Andrew Yang Super PAC to exclusively accept bitcoin donations for the first 21 days

Humanity Forward Fund, a Super PAC that supports Andrew Yang for President, has partnered with OpenNode to exclusively accept bitcoin donations for the first 21 days. After that, it will also accept donations in fiat. The fund vouches to refuse all “dark money” and disclose exactly how the money is spent.
The bitcoin donations will be processed by OpenNode, which also supports payments through the Lightning Network. OpenNode charges a 1% processing fee, which is significantly lower than what card processors charge, according to founder Seth Cohen.
